Raisi extends good wishes to Saudi King on national day

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i extends good wishes to Saudi Arabia's King Salman and Crown Prince Mohammed on their country's National Day, expressing hope for expanded relations between the two nations.

Iranian President Ebrahim Raisi extended on Saturday his heartfelt wishes to King Salman bin Abdulaziz and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man on the occasion of Saudi Arabia's National Day.

In a statement released by the Iranian Presidency, it was conveyed that President Raisi sent separate messages to King Salman and Crown Prince Mohammed on the anniversary of the Saudi National Day.

The statement went on to highlight the shared political and economic interests between Iran and Saudi Arabia: emphasizing that the common cultural bonds serve as a strong foundation for friendship between the two Islamic nations, contributing to the enhancement of mutual ties.

Furthermore, President Raisi expressed his hopes for the expansion of relations between the two countries in all areas.

Earlier this month, Abdullah bin Saud al-Anzi, the newly appointed Saudi Arabian Ambassador to Tehran, expressed his utmost satisfaction regarding the recent reestablishment of diplomatic relations between the two nations during a meeting hosted at the Chinese embassy in Tehran. 

Al-Anzi emphasized that these ties would flourish across various domains, encompassing trade, economics, and investment through fostering bilateral relations.
